[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: UTF-8 characters in filenames with Lilypond 2.23
From: |
Jean Abou Samra |
Subject: |
Re: UTF-8 characters in filenames with Lilypond 2.23 |
Date: |
Sun, 22 May 2022 01:01:08 +0200 |
User-agent: |
Mozilla/5.0 (X11; Linux x86_64; rv:91.0) Gecko/20100101 Thunderbird/91.8.1 |
Le 21/05/2022 à 23:20, David F. a écrit :
System: Intel-based macOS
I make extensive use of UTF-8 characters in the filenames of my Lilypond files.
This works in Lilypond up through version 2.22. But Lilypond 2.23 cannot
handle UTF-8 characters in filenames.
Filename: tést.ly
====
\version "2.22"
{ c' }
====
Under v2.22, this file complies without problem. With 2.23 (including the just
release 2.23.9) I get the following error:
Starting lilypond 2.23.9 [tést.ly]...
warning: cannot find file: `/Users/david/Projects/Lily Scratch/te??st.ly'
fatal error: failed files: "/Users/david/Projects/Lily Scratch/te??st.ly"
Exited with return code 1.
I thought that this problem had already been reported, but I can’t find any
mention of it now. So I’m reporting it.
David F.
This is actually not an issue with LilyPond, but with Frescobaldi,
when you have "run LilyPond with English messages" enabled in the
Preferences. This problem is known for some time already, but
I didn't see an issue in the Frescobaldi tracker, so I just
opened one:
https://github.com/frescobaldi/frescobaldi/issues/1438
The workaround is to uncheck "Run LilyPond with English messages"
in Edit > Preferences > LilyPond Preferences.
Best,
Jean
Re: UTF-8 characters in filenames with Lilypond 2.23, Jonas Hahnfeld, 2022/05/25